Fuel vapor canister for Citroën and Peugeot vehicles.

The active charcoal (carbon) canister is an essential component of the EVAP (evaporative emission) system on many Citroën and Peugeot models. It captures fuel vapors from the fuel tank, stores them safely and then allows the engine to burn the collected vapors via the purge circuit. How It Is Replaced

Replacement is straightforward for a trained mechanic or an experienced DIYer with basic tools and safe lifting equipment: raise and support the vehicle, locate the canister (typically near the fuel tank or mounted in the rear underbody/wheel arch), disconnect the purge solenoid electrical connector and all vapor and vent hoses, remove mounting fasteners, and install the new canister in reverse order. Inspect and replace any brittle hoses, clamps and the purge valve if necessary. After fitting, clear any EVAP-related fault codes and perform an OBD check to confirm correct system operation.

Why This Part Fails

  • Charcoal Saturation: Over time the activated carbon can become saturated with fuel and contaminants, reducing adsorption efficiency.
  • Physical Damage: Cracks or broken mounting points and damaged hose connections allow unmetered air or water ingress.
  • Contamination: Fuel overfill, liquid fuel entering the canister or water intrusion can clog the unit and purge lines.
  • Associated Component Failure: Faulty purge solenoid valves, clogged vent lines or failed non-return valves often cause symptoms that lead to canister replacement.
